Rear housing - no fire or fuel - running on one rotor
 
i've got an engine with a problem i've never seen before;

this is on a '93 r1... the engine has new leaing and trailing plugs.

what's going on is this:
- front housing leading plug-tip is light brown from 5mins of idle
- front housing trailing plug-tip is also light colored brown/copper (show little signs of use as these are brand new plugs)

- rear housing trailing plug - doesn't look like it fired but the electrode-tip is covered in oil (just the the electrode tip)
- rear leading plug is spotless - doesn't look like it's even seen fire

the car will run on the front housing and idles poorly. what i've done for testing:
- jumped both primaries at the ECU side - i could hear them open & close
- also removed primaries and directly supplied power.. same open/close results
- replaced coil packs with coils within mazdas workshop manual sepcs
- ensured fail is at the rail, etc

i did deflood the car - didn't get any black soot or oil shooting from the housings. i'm sure that the car is running on one rotor because it runs 12:1 at idle and jumps up to 19:1 if the car sees load at which point it'll die. the rear leading plug being spotless is also another indication that the rear isn't seeing fuel and/or firing.

i do not notice any fuel on the plugs but i haven't testing the injectors alone (could disable the coils and check for fuel on the plugs).

anyhow i'm getting nowhere and needing pointers/help
